DEPARTMENT OF DEFENSE

Office of the Secretary


Defense Science Board Task Force on Improvements to Services 
Contracting; Notice of Advisory Committee Meetings

AGENCY: Department of Defense (DOD).

ACTION: Notice of advisory committee meetings.

-----------------------------------------------------------------------

SUMMARY: The Defense Science Board Task Force on Improvements to 
Services Contracting will meet in closed session on July 28-29 and on 
September 22-23, 2010, in Arlington, VA.

DATES: The meetings will be held on July 28-29 and on September 22-23, 
2010.

ADDRESSES: Both meetings will be held at Strategic Analysis, Inc., 4075 
Wilson Boulevard, Suite 350, Arlington, VA.

SUPPLEMENTARY INFORMATION: The mission of the Defense Science Board is 
to advise the Secretary of Defense and the Under Secretary of Defense 
for Acquisition, Technology & Logistics on scientific and technical 
matters as they affect the perceived needs of the Department of 
Defense. Both meetings will assess the quality and completeness of 
guidance relating to the procurement of services, including 
implementation of statutory and regulatory authorities and 
requirements.
    The task force's findings and recommendations, pursuant to 41 CFR 
102-3.140 through 102-3.165, will be presented and discussed by the 
membership of the Defense Science Board prior to being presented to the 
Government's decision maker.
    Pursuant to 41 CFR 102-3.120 and 102-3.150, the Designated Federal 
Officer for the Defense Science Board will determine and announce in 
the Federal Register when the findings and recommendations of the July 
28-29 and September 22-23, 2010, meetings are deliberated by the 
Defense Science Board.

    Interested persons may submit a written statement for consideration 
by the Defense Science Board. Individuals submitting a written 
statement must submit their statement to the Designated Federal 
Official (see FOR FURTHER INFORMATION CONTACT), at any point, however, 
if a written statement is not received at least 10 calendar days prior 
to the meetings, which are the subject of this notice, then it may not 
be provided to or considered by the Defense Science Board. The 
Designated Federal Official will review all timely submissions with the 
Defense Science Board Chairperson, and ensure they are provided to 
members of the Defense Science Board before the meetings that are the 
subject of this notice.
